Are Purdue dorms coed?

Undergraduate Information All locations in the undergraduate residences are co-ed with the exception of the following: All Male: Cary Quadrangle, McCutcheon Hall, Tarkington Hall and Wiley Hall. All Female: Meredith Hall, Meredith South Hall and Windsor Halls.

Can you get a meal plan if you live off campus Purdue?

Students who live in Hawkins Hall or Hilltop Apartments may select a meal plan when they sign their housing contract but are not required to do so.

In addition to our dining court facilities, we have added new retail locations where your swipes and Dining Dollars will be accepted (Jersey Mike’s, Chick-Fil-A, Qdoba and Panera Bread to name a few!). There will also be mobile pick-up and new On-The-Go options on the academic side of campus, as well.

Do dining dollars roll over Purdue?

Unused Dining Dollars are not refundable, as they are a part of your contract meal plan and expire at the end of the contract. Dining Dollars will be carried over from fall to spring semester.

How much is a meal plan at FSU?

100 Flex Block: 100 meals per semester (equates to about 6 meals per week), 3 guest passes, $500 FlexBucks. Cost: $1,375* 65 Seminole**: 65 meals per semester (equates to about 4 meals per week), 3 guest passes, $100 FlexBucks. Cost: $648*2019年8月22日

Do freshmen have to live on campus at FSU?

Although no student is required to reside in University housing facilities, entering freshmen are encouraged to do so to avail themselves of the opportunities provided by the University Housing staff. Great effort is taken to provide students with a variety of alternatives and choices in residence hall living.
